Wuhuang Mountain is a famous national geological park. It is renowned for its strange stones, steep mountains, and magnificent sea of clouds and peaks. It has extremely rich and unique tourism resources and is known as a natural oxygen bar and forest bath. The natural landscapes in the scenic area are also particularly abundant, including Fairy Pool, Headstone Waterfall, Sister Chasing Village’s strange stone group, thousand-year stone steps, terraced fields and waterwheels. Here is also a national-level protected forest area of Castanopsis hystrix. There are as many as 120,000 mu of continuous Castanopsis hystrix forests. The climate here is also very unique. It is surrounded by clouds and mist all year round. Dense forests, secluded valleys and streams form a beautiful natural landscape. In particular, the vivid Giant Yang Stone attracts countless tourists to worship. Sceneries such as Double Breast Peaks also make people’s imagination run wild.
